package java.security;

/**
 * This interface specified no methods.  In simply provides a common
 * super-interface for all algorithm specific private key values.
 *
 * @author Aaron M. Renn (arenn@urbanophile.com)
 * @see Key
 * @see PublicKey
 * @see Certificate
 * @see Signature#initVerify(PublicKey)
 * @see DSAPrivateKey
 * @see RSAPrivateKey
 * @see RSAPrivateCrtKey
 * @since 1.1
 * @status updated to 1.4
 */
public interface PrivateKey extends Key
{
  /**
   * The version identifier used for serialization.
   */
  long serialVersionUID = 6034044314589513430L;
} // interface PrivateKey

from __future__ import annotations

"""Representations specific to the Texas Instruments compiler family."""

import os
import typing as T

from ...mesonlib import EnvironmentException

if T.TYPE_CHECKING:
    from ...envconfig import MachineInfo
    from ...environment import Environment
    from ...compilers.compilers import Compiler
else:
    # This is a bit clever, for mypy we pretend that these mixins descend from
    # Compiler, so we get all of the methods and attributes defined for us, but
    # for runtime we make them descend from object (which all classes normally
    # do). This gives up DRYer type checking, with no runtime impact
    Compiler = object

ti_buildtype_args = {
    'plain': [],
    'debug': [],
    'debugoptimized': [],
    'release': [],
    'minsize': [],
    'custom': [],
}  # type: T.Dict[str, T.List[str]]

ti_optimization_args = {
    'plain': [],
    '0': ['-O0'],
    'g': ['-Ooff'],
    '1': ['-O1'],
    '2': ['-O2'],
    '3': ['-O3'],
    's': ['-O4']
}  # type: T.Dict[str, T.List[str]]

ti_debug_args = {
    False: [],
    True: ['-g']
}  # type: T.Dict[bool, T.List[str]]


class TICompiler(Compiler):

    id = 'ti'

    def __init__(self) -> None:
        if not self.is_cross:
            raise EnvironmentException('TI compilers only support cross-compilation.')

        self.can_compile_suffixes.add('asm')    # Assembly
        self.can_compile_suffixes.add('cla')    # Control Law Accelerator (CLA) used in C2000

        default_warn_args = []  # type: T.List[str]
        self.warn_args = {'0': [],
                          '1': default_warn_args,
                          '2': default_warn_args + [],
                          '3': default_warn_args + [],
                          'everything': default_warn_args + []}  # type: T.Dict[str, T.List[str]]

    def get_pic_args(self) -> T.List[str]:
        # PIC support is not enabled by default for TI compilers,
        # if users want to use it, they need to add the required arguments explicitly
        return []

    def get_buildtype_args(self, buildtype: str) -> T.List[str]:
        return ti_buildtype_args[buildtype]

    def get_pch_suffix(self) -> str:
        return 'pch'

    def get_pch_use_args(self, pch_dir: str, header: str) -> T.List[str]:
        return []

    def thread_flags(self, env: 'Environment') -> T.List[str]:
        return []

    def get_coverage_args(self) -> T.List[str]:
        return []

    def get_no_stdinc_args(self) -> T.List[str]:
        return []

    def get_no_stdlib_link_args(self) -> T.List[str]:
        return []

    def get_optimization_args(self, optimization_level: str) -> T.List[str]:
        return ti_optimization_args[optimization_level]

    def get_debug_args(self, is_debug: bool) -> T.List[str]:
        return ti_debug_args[is_debug]

    def get_compile_only_args(self) -> T.List[str]:
        return []

    def get_no_optimization_args(self) -> T.List[str]:
        return ['-Ooff']

    def get_output_args(self, target: str) -> T.List[str]:
        return [f'--output_file={target}']

    def get_werror_args(self) -> T.List[str]:
        return ['--emit_warnings_as_errors']

    def get_include_args(self, path: str, is_system: bool) -> T.List[str]:
        if path == '':
            path = '.'
        return ['-I=' + path]

    @classmethod
    def _unix_args_to_native(cls, args: T.List[str], info: MachineInfo) -> T.List[str]:
        result = []
        for i in args:
            if i.startswith('-D'):
                i = '--define=' + i[2:]
            if i.startswith('-Wl,-rpath='):
                continue
            elif i == '--print-search-dirs':
                continue
            elif i.startswith('-L'):
                continue
            result.append(i)
        return result
